VE Series 1, 250K km. There's a battery drain issue - sometimes it goes three days and is fine, sometimes it goes flat overnight - but it has recently been having trouble starting even with a new battery installed. Video example - it's about 30 seconds long and it catches at the end:
Once it finally catches there's often a flash of warnings - commonly ABS/Stability Control/Check Engine - for a brief moment before they vanish.
Sometimes the starter only gives a sad sounding bark, once, and doesn't go any further until you turn the key back and try again, where it will just do the same thing. Leave it for a while, come back and sometimes it will start up normally.
I have connected it to various OBD2 software and no fault seems to be found.
What's all this a symptom of? I thought it might be the starter motor but now it's cranking but not firing as often as it is doing the sad bark thing...
Oh, and when it does start up it takes a couple of seconds for the tacho to register anything. Is that usual?
